  8. New York City Police Department Organized Crime Control ...

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/New_York_City_Police...

    The Organized Crime Control Bureau ( OCCB) was one of the ten bureaus that formed the New York Police Department. The Bureau was charged with the investigation and prevention of organized crime within New York City. The OCCB was disbanded in March 2016 with all investigative entities moved to the Chief of Detectives' office. [2]
